So last weekend saw the return of Upfest, Europe’s largest street art and graffiti festival, and yet another reason why Bristol is one of the best cities to spend a summer in. Upfest, in its 10th year, attracts over 400 artists from around the world to paint venues across Bedminster and Southville. In between torrential rain…
